Heritage Insurance Holdings posted Q2 2026 net income of $61.7 million, up 28.5%, with diluted EPS rising 32.3% to $2.05.
Revenue increased 3% to $214.2 million, helped by higher net premiums earned and investment income.
Profitability strengthened as the net combined ratio improved 8 percentage points to 64.9%, with the net loss ratio down 8.1 percentage points to 30.4%.
Cash flow and capital position
Cash flow from operations more than doubled to $166.5 million; book value per share climbed 16.5% from year-end 2025 to $19.09.
Heritage entered Texas on a surplus lines basis; CEO Ernie Garateix said the company is generating record earnings, producing excess capital, and sees a foundation for future growth.
